2Gens IATs and the Mazda MPV

Out of all the cars in Mazdas' 1980s lineup, it seems like I'm always substituting broken engine/chassis parts with pieces from the MPV!

Anyway, just wanted to let everyone know that you can use the Intake Air Temp (IAT) sensor from a V-6 MPV (88-90 so far) in place of the the often fragile piece on our 2nd gens-screws right in, plugs right up.
